Control the risk by changing their setting or by getting appropriate personal safety equipment. "Line-of-fire" is an armed forces term that describes the course of gunfire or a missile. Nonetheless, in Sector, Line of Fire refers to employees who put themselves in damage's way by standing in the incorrect place at the incorrect time and afterwards being available in call with some kind of power.
